Take No Hold

A Poem by KWP

cast out to the rough seas in the everywhen 

our love story only ever fleeting,

zenith in the tempest storm,


rallying and riling holds no key, 

all that comes together, falls apart,


stormy weather cleanses hearts, 

leaves one gasping for sweet more

the weather does pass,


the new breeze manipulates a soft touch 

catches hold, 

tickling in presence,


alas a moment,

fleeting splash, erupting forth from

rapids of eternity - 

rough waters pass, 

nothing ever lasts


tilt your head, watch the stars 

inhale the allness of the everywhen, 

it’s you, 

it’s all you,

oh yes, I’m in there too 


open your heart so wide

nothing can ever take hold 

in your crevasse of all encompassing 

cold winds chill, 

the breath, love and life, warms 

transient in exhale, 

never catching a snag,

it’s you, 

it’s all of you 


nectars drip, satiate every sense,

belonging,

in an overflowing cup of abundance, 

drop the fear,

take it, 

it was always yours to grasp

it’s the essence of you

take it, understand it, 

let it go

you - - -
